IE7 keeps stealing focus, even after I use TweakUI.

I have to use IE for a work application. The app spawns a new popup window for each task I work on. Because I multitask and the network can be slow, I have multiple task windows open at once, usually at least one loading in the background while I work on the other.

Every time IE finishes loading a task window, that window pops to the front and steals focus.

I have used TweakUI to "prevent applications from stealing focus" but IE seems not to listen. Help me stop this annoying behavior and keep sane!

(Windows XP professional, SP2, IE 7.0.5730.11)
